摘要
Many technical fan installations involve a duct on the inlet side and/or outlet side of a fan. Therefore the need arises for a measurement method for determination of the sound power radiated by fans or other fluid handling sources into a duct. In this paper the problems associated with such a method are discussed: Axial standing waves due to sound reflections from the duct end, acoustic loading of the source, turbulent flow pressures superimposed on the sound field, flow noise generated by flow/microphone probe interaction (self noise), discrimination between sound pressures and turbulent flow pressures, measurement position in the duct in view of higher-order mode sound propagation and directional characteristic of the microphone probe used, and modal distribution of sound power. Early and recent work on the above topics is reviewed. A brief description of the standardized in-duct method ISO 5136:1990 [1] as well as the revised version ISO/DIS 5136:1999 [2] is given.
